
CIUDAD JUÁREZ, Mexico – Coming off of a tournament-opening win over Panama, the U.S. returns to Estadio Juárez Vive for a pool play matchup against Nicaragua at the 2025 World Baseball Softball Confederation (WBSC) Pan American Championship. The game is scheduled to start at 3:00 p.m. MDT/5:00 p.m. ET.

THE MATCHUP
Team USA has met Nicaragua two times at the U-15 level and owns an unblemished 2-0 overall record in the matchup. The two nations first met in 2015, when the U.S. picked up a 17-2 win in the COPABE Pan Am “AA” Championships. The most recent and last contest between the two occurred in 2017 resulting in another win for the stars and stripes. In the 2017 COPABE Pan Am “AA” Championships, Team USA collected a 12-2 win over Nicaragua.
PUTTING THE BALL IN PLAY
Louis Lappe had opposing pitchers shaking on the mound in the opening game of the 2025 WBSC Pan American Championship. The slugger went 3-for-4 in the match versus Panama and notched an RBI. Two of Lappe’s hits came in the form of doubles to the outfield wall with one hit occurring in a crucial moment to give Team USA momentum in the 4-2 victory.
ON THE BIG STAGE AGAIN
The 2025 15U National Team roster welcomes back five USA Baseball alumni who have prior experience in international competition. In 2022, the fivesome of Colin Anderson, Anthony Frausto, Tristin Gaines, Mateo Mier, and Trent O’Malley traveled with the 12U National Team to Tainan, Taiwan to compete in the WBSC U-12 Baseball World Cup. There, the group compiled 38 hits, 41 RBIs, and 12 homers to lift the 12U National Team to its fifth gold medal in program history.
BEEN THERE, DONE THAT
Frausto, a three-time USA Baseball alum, joins USA Baseball for the second consecutive summer after first cracking a USA Baseball roster with the 12U National Team in 2022. There, Frausto won a gold medal with the team and was named to the All-World Team as a first baseman. Following his stint with the 12U National Team, Frausto joined the 2024 15U National Team after earning a spot at Training Camp through USA Baseball’s 13U/14U Athlete Development Program (ADP). With the 2024 15U National Team, Frausto guided the stars and stripes to an unblemished record against Australia in an International Friendship Series. Now, Frausto enters his third stint with Team USA where he is set to provide a veteran presence to the team.
GOLD MEDAL TENDENCIES
The 2025 15U National Team features a staff full of familiar faces who have served the 15U National Team in a wide range of capacities. Drew Briese and Steve Butler, who both coached on the 2022 15U National Team, bring gold medal experience after winning the title at the 2022 V WBSC U-15 Baseball World Cup in Hermosillo, Mexico. The duo helped guide the 15U National Team to an 8-1 overall record while also outscoring opponents 99-30 in nine games.
THE ROSTER
The 2025 15U National Team features a 20-player roster that boasts five USA Baseball alumni and 12 athletes who have prior involvement with USA Baseball’s 13U/14U Athlete Development Program (ADP).
In addition to the five alumni on the roster, 12 total players have experience participating in USA Baseball’s 13U/14U ADP, which is a program centralized around the development of amateur athletes on and off of the field. Anderson, Frausto, Noah Jarolimek, and Nateo Victorio all made the trip to Cary in 2023. Last year’s ADP saw Anderson, Greyson Bell, Yariel Diaz, Frausto, Gaines, Jason Marll Jr., Mier, Nolyn Nickels, and O’Malley thrive at the event.
